'the major fantasy work of the '80s... It is a book that makes one proud to be working in the same genre as its author' Charles de Lint Concluding this vast epic fantasy, The Darkest Road carries the young heroes from our own world to the final titanic battle for Fionavar against the evil of Rakoth Maugrim. On a ghost-ship the legendary Warrior, Arthur Pendragon and Pwyll Twiceborn, Lord of the Summer Tree, sail to confront the Unraveller; while Darien, Child of Light and Dark, must tread the darkest road...
